A complex adaptation must be universal within a species.: 

A complex adaptation must be universal within a species. Imagine a complex adaptation – say, part of an eye – that has 6 necessary proteins. If each gene is at 10% frequency, the chance of assembling a working eye is 1:1,000,000. Pieces 1 through 5 must already be fixed in the gene pool, before natural selection will promote an extra, helpful piece 6 to fixation. Eliezer Yudkowsky Singularity Institute for AI (John Tooby and Leda Cosmides, 1992. The Psychological Foundations of Culture. In The Adapted Mind, eds. Barkow, Cosmides, and Tooby.)

Happiness set points:: 

Happiness set points: After one year, lottery winners were not much happier than a control group, and paraplegics were not much unhappier. People underestimate adjustments because they focus on the initial surprise. Eliezer Yudkowsky Singularity Institute for AI (Brickman, P., Coates, D., & Janoff-Bulman, R. (1978). Lottery winners and accident victims: is happiness relative? Journal of Personality and Social Psychology, 37, 917-927.)

“Hedonic treadmill” effects:: 

“Hedonic treadmill” effects: (Source: Survey by PNC Advisors. http://www.sharpenet.com/gt/issues/2005/mar05/1.shtml) Eliezer Yudkowsky Singularity Institute for AI People with $500,000-$1,000,000 in assets say they would need an average of $2.4 million to feel “financially secure”. People with $5 million feel they need at least $10 million. People with $10 million feel they need at least $18 million.

Your life circumstances make little difference in how happy you are.: 

Your life circumstances make little difference in how happy you are. “The fundamental surprise of well-being research is the robust finding that life circumstances make only a small contribution to the variance of happiness—far smaller than the contribution of inherited temperament or personality. Although people have intense emotional reactions to major changes in the circumstances of their lives, these reactions appear to subside more or less completely, and often quite quickly... After a period of adjustment lottery winners are not much happier than a control group and paraplegics not much unhappier.” (Daniel Kahneman, 2000. “Experienced Utility and Objective Happiness: A Moment-Based Approach.” In Choices, Values, and Frames, D. Kahneman and A. Tversky (Eds.) New York: Cambridge University Press.) Findable online, or google “hedonic psychology”. Eliezer Yudkowsky Singularity Institute for AI

Nurture is built atop nature:: 

Nurture is built atop nature: Growing a fur coat in response to cold weather requires more genetic complexity than growing a fur coat. (George C. Williams, 1966. Adaptation and Natural Selection. Princeton University Press.) Humans learn different languages depending on culture, but this cultural dependency rests on a sophisticated cognitive adaptation: mice don’t do it. (John Tooby and Leda Cosmides, 1992. The Psychological Foundations of Culture. In The Adapted Mind, eds. Barkow, Cosmides, and Tooby.) Eliezer Yudkowsky Singularity Institute for AI
